## Service Accounts — TerraTrek Offline Mode

When TerraTrek field units lose connectivity, queued survey batches sync through the `trektide-offline` service account once a link is restored. The release manager must verify this account is provisioned before each regional rollout, since a missing grant silently drops batches after three retries. Scope it to sync-write only, never admin. The key the sync daemon must present at startup is as follows.

API key for yahig-tadup: kto7_ubizbYm

The Quillpress rendering pipeline converts raw markdown to sanitized HTML via the internal Renderhub endpoint. All requests require the shared pipeline key in the `Authorization` header. Rate limits apply per key, not per caller. Do not mint your own key; use the team key, which follows below.

app token of badug-tahaf = qvz11-nP5FBNr8qnh

**Vendor note: Inkmill markdown pipeline**

Rendering for Parchway docs is outsourced to Inkmill under an annual contract, renewing each March. They handle sanitization and PDF export; we own the upload queue. SLA: 4-hour response on rendering failures. Escalate only after two failed retries. Their support desk is reachable at the address below.

billing contact of hahaf-baguf = zorael.tammir.jorius@sivrelhq.internal